Hypnotic

2021 DramaHorrorMysteryThriller 89mins M 5.7 / 10 IMDb 5.3 / 10

A young woman seeking self-improvement enlists the help of a renowned hypnotist but, after a handful of intense sessions, discovers unexpected and deadly consequences.

Hypnotic: Cast & Crews

Directors
Matt Angel
Top Cast
Kate Siegel, Jason O'Mara, Dulé Hill, Lucie Guest, Jaime M. Callica

Got a question about Hypnotic?

Hypnotic offers a unique blend of psychological suspense and thriller elements that may appeal to fans of the genre. The film explores themes of manipulation and self-discovery, which can resonate with viewers looking for a thought-provoking experience. While it has its flaws, including pacing issues, the intriguing premise and some strong performances make it worth a watch, especially for those interested in psychological dramas.
